10 Easy Foods To Eat Everyday To Maintain A Healthy Life

Pili nuts provide those who wish to fight stress and live healthy with a healthy alternative to the usual snack foods. But did you know that there are 10 more easy foods to eat each day that will also help you stay healthy? Read on to learn more.

1. BEANS

Beans are recommended as a helpful source of iron and regular consumption of beans allows oxygen to travel much more freely from the lungs to all of the other important areas of the body. Beans are also plant based, which enables faster iron absorption.

2. EGGS

Not only are eggs rich in protein, but they also promote an increased feeling of satiety after a meal, which keeps us from reaching for the unhealthy snacks. They are also chock full of antioxidants that are responsible for ocular health, as well.

3. STRAWBERRIES/BLUEBERRIES/RASPBERRIES

Berries provide a great source of fiber, taste delicious and ensure increased digestive health. Raspberries are rich in anti cancer properties, blueberries offer plentiful antioxidants and strawberries contain a full day's dosage of Vitamin C.

4. PILI NUTS

These nuts are filled with magnesium and Vitamin E, and those who consume them on a regular basis are able to have healthy skin, able to manage stress better and perfect for energy metabolism.

5. ORANGES

Did you know that just one glass of orange juice is all you need for a full daily supply of Vitamin C? Oranges also helps to safeguard the white blood cells and keep the immune system safe from infections. The cells are also protected from damage caused by free radicals.

6. BROCCOLI

Broccoli contains multiple vitamins, including K, A, and C. These vitamins make our bones healthier and stronger and broccoli also contains sulforaphane, which stimulates enzymes responsible for fighting cancerous cells.

7. SPINACH

As it turns out, Popeye had the right idea. Spinach is chock full of vitamins and nutrients, including calcium, magnesium, fiber, iron, vitamin E and magnesium. Spinach is recommended for pregnant mothers, as it is rich in folate, a vitamin that helps to create new cells.

8. YOGHURT

Yogurt is jam packed with "good" bacteria, which help to ward off illnesses that are related to age. A cup of yogurt also provides half of our necessary daily dose of calcium and keeps osteoporosis at bay.

9. TEA

Drinking tea daily reduces the risk of numerous diseases, including Alzheimer's and diabetes. Tea is also rich in flavonoids, an antioxidant that strengthens tea, gum and bones.

10. SWEET POTATOES

The orange coloration of sweet potatoes is caused by their large amounts of beta and alpha carotene. Eating sweet potatoes each day keeps the body's immune system in perfect working order and aids bone and eye health.
